My name is Sacha Masek and I work for a non-profit research organization located in Salt Lake City, Utah (USA) called the Sorenson Molecular Genealogy Foundation (SMGF). The main purpose of SMGF is to build a large and comprehensive database of correlated genetic and genealogical data representing as many populations and family history lineages worldwide. It is our desire to assist family historians in searching their ancestors and finding common connections using the tools of genetic genealogy. I am contacting you today to see if you have interest in learning more about our research and to ask for your assistance in collecting DNA and genealogies from Russia that will be added to our publicly available online databases.
Participation in the global SMGF database is free, private, and voluntary. Both male and female participants as young as 7 years of age are eligible to participate by submitting a copy of their pedigree chart and a simple mouthwash rinse to the study. This material is then shipped and analyzed at our laboratories in Utah, where paperwork and samples are coded and personal information from the donors is kept confidential. Genealogical data prior to 1900 and anonymous genetic data obtained from the samples are then uploaded in a public database available online at www.smgf.org. The study is reviewed quarterly by the Western Institutional Review Board (www.WIRB.com).
We are interested in making contacts with individuals who speak English and have access to the internet who would be willing to make collections of DNA and genealogies among their family and friends where they live. Again, there is no cost to the participant. We are willing to pay up to $5 USD per usable sample to a collector who returns collections of 20 or more participants.
